This example shows how to use the Channel Setup Wizard to configure an outside air sensor.
- Launch the Channel Setup Wizard, either by clicking the button at the end of the Auto Discover Wizard or by clicking the button in the Modules Layer.
The Channel Setup Wizard can be used only after a device has first been detected. For a guide on how to detect the sensor, see Detect A Battery-Powered Sensor Via via .
- Choose the channel type as Analogue Input and the channel number as Temperature Sensor, and then click next.

The Channel Setup Wizard is now complete.
If the device has any channels that have not yet been configured, you will be given the option to re-run the wizard in order to configure those channels. You may either run the wizard again now or return to it at a later stage, via the Modules Layer.
